	 <t>   This document presents an architecture for IPv6 access networks that
   decouples the network-layer concepts of Links, Interface, and Subnets
   from the link-layer concepts of links, ports, and broadcast domains,
   and limits the reliance on link-layer broadcasts.  This architecture
   is suitable for IPv6 over any network, including non-broadcast
   networks.  A study of the issues with ND-Classic over wireless media
   is presented, and a framework to solve those issues within the new
   architecture is proposed.
